ZModeler3 services are being moved to a new hosting provider. The website, forum and account have been already moved and tested on new servers, but the domain zmodeler3.com is still pointing to old servers. The planned update of domain name is scheduled on May 5th, 23:00 UTC. I expect name servers to propagate and resolve to new domain in 8-12 hours, but it could take up to 24-48 hours actually.

It have to be explicitly stated, that web account will be inaccessible during this time. It is strongly advised to prepare your installed licenses for offline - ZModeler can work in offline mode with preinstalled licenses for several days (up to 3 days on trial license and up to 6 days on 30-days paid licenses). By reinstalling your current license key in ZModeler, you grant it an offline validity for this period.

Those with licenses expiring at the given time period will be unable to purchase new license, activate, install and/or validate licenses during these hours. If possible, apply new licenses in advance to avoid interruption of functionality of ZModeler.

If upon reload (CTRL+F5) of main page you do not see this post on top, then you are on the new server and web account is ready to serve you fully as usual.
